Kansas City Royals Logo History

The visible center of the Kansas city Royals logo has remained surely intact for the reason that baseball crew turned into installed in 1969.

Meaning of Kansas City Royals Logo

The logo is credited to the Hallmark cards agency mounted in 1910. versions of the logo have been submitted with the aid of 15 artists. At step one, the works of three artists have been selected, after which each of them turned into asked to increase numerous more versions in their designs. whilst the work turned into over, Shannon Manning’s design changed into selected out of all the trademarks furnished for the competition.
Manning’s emblem looked somewhat unusual for the era – a bit too minimalistic and geometric, in comparison with the logotypes of other groups. The royal blue shield topped through a crown housed a large letter “R” in white, with the gold “KC” lettering at the top proper-hand nook.

In 1979, the relatively easy font for the word “Royals” beneath the protect changed into changed by way of a script. The wordmark color turned into modified from yellow to blue. on the 1986 model, the phrase “Royals” have become bigger in comparison with the guard, while the 1993 variant changed gold through the silver coloration.

In 2002, the capital “R” disappeared from the guard. rather, there was the “KC” lettering.

Symbol of Kansas City Royals Logo

The cap insignia capabilities the interlocking letters “ok” and “C” in gold at the blue background. The script appears the same as that used at the defend KC Royals emblem.

Emblem of Kansas City Royals Logo

The Anniversary KC Royals emblem features a modernized protect with the quantity “50” crowned by a crown. on the left, the year when the franchise turned into founded (1969) is given, on the right, there is the yr of the team’s fiftieth season (2018).

Kansas City Royals Logo’s Font

The script featured at the “Royals” lettering is a custom paintings, as are the letters “ok” and “C”. None of them seems to belong to an current typeface.

Kansas City Royals Logo’s Color

The crew’s palette encompasses the four colours: royal blue (hex: #004687), gold (#C09A5B), light blue (#7AB2DD), and white (#FFFFFF).
